About the White Finish
At 271cm this is a large wardrobe, and white is the finish that lets you have that much storage without the room paying for it. A wardrobe of this width in a dark colour becomes the defining element of the bedroom whether you intend it to or not. A white carcase and doors let the piece recede into the wall, while the six Atlantic Dark Oak drawer fronts give it definition and stop it reading as a blank expanse. It is the combination that makes a large wardrobe feel considered rather than imposing.
The six-door layout uses that contrast particularly well. Because the two centre doors run full height with no drawers beneath them, the oak sits as two distinct blocks at either end of the wardrobe rather than one continuous band across the bottom. The white centre section separates them, giving the front a composed, symmetrical arrangement rather than a repeating one across nearly three metres.
That centre compartment is also the practical reason to choose the six-door over the smaller models. It is a full 90cm of uninterrupted hanging space – no drawers cutting it short – so coats, dresses, suit carriers and anything else needing the full drop has a proper home. Large wardrobes often give you more of the same thing: four identical compartments, all cut short by the same fittings. Here you get three distinct zones, two for everyday clothes and one for the long garments that have nowhere else to go.
The six drawers are arranged in three graduated depths, and each depth exists because something specific needs to go in it. The top drawer in each bank is 6cm deep with interior dividers – a jewellery, watch, cufflink, belt and sock drawer, for the things that get lost at the bottom of a deep drawer or end up in a dish on the chest. Below it an 8cm drawer for underwear, socks and folded lightweights. At the bottom, a 20cm drawer for jumpers, jeans and anything bulky.
Because the banks sit at opposite ends of the wardrobe rather than side by side, two people sharing get a genuinely separate half each – a drawer bank and a hanging compartment apiece, with the full-height centre as shared space. On a wardrobe this wide that separation is worth more than the raw storage volume. Each drawer is 85cm wide and 39cm deep internally, a proper size rather than a token one, running on metal runners for smooth, reliable use.
Behind the doors, each of the three 90cm compartments has a height-adjustable shelf and a metal hanging rail rated to 40kg. The shelf positions to suit what you actually own rather than sitting where the factory decided, so the centre compartment can be set for full-length hanging while the outer sections carry more folded storage – or the other way round.
Usable interior depth is 50cm, so garments hang square rather than pressing against the doors. The shelves are 1.6cm thick and the rails are metal rather than plastic. If you want more from the interior, additional shelves, interior drawers, lighting, pull-out rails and dividers can all be added as optional extras before you order.
At 210cm high it fits a standard modern bedroom without needing a specialist ceiling height, and the 54cm depth keeps the footprint modest for a wardrobe that also absorbs six drawers' worth of storage. In most bedrooms this replaces a wardrobe and a chest of drawers together, so the floor space gained elsewhere often offsets the width.

Kodi belongs to the Rauch Orange range and is 100% Made in Germany, carrying both the Blue Angel and the Golden M seals. Blue Angel is an independently verified low-emission certification, meaningful for a piece of furniture this large in a room you sleep in, and the Golden M is Germany's recognised furniture quality mark. How much space do I need to install it?
Allow 25cm of clearance for installation. On a wardrobe of this width it is worth measuring the full run of wall before ordering, including skirting boards, radiators and any point where the wall is not perfectly square.
Is a wardrobe this large right for my room?
At 271cm wide it needs a substantial run of clear wall, but at 54cm deep the footprint is no greater than a smaller wardrobe. Because it also holds six drawers, it commonly replaces a wardrobe and a chest of drawers together – so the floor space gained elsewhere often offsets the width. In White it also carries less visual weight than the darker finishes.
